Cabbage diseases and pests: description and control methods

Cabbage is a cold-resistant crop. However, it is quite sensitive; improper cultivation practices and neglect of disease and pest prevention can lead to the death of the entire crop.

Healthy and sick cabbage

Possible causes of cabbage wilting

Plants thrive best when temperatures do not exceed 20°C. Seedlings may wilt due to unfavorable conditions.

These include:

  • lack of light;
  • dry air;
  • lack of minerals;
  • waterlogged soil;
  • infectious pathologies;
  • high pH level;
  • improper care.

After germination, the boxes should be moved to a cool room. Seedlings are particularly vulnerable during the first 10 days after planting in open ground. This is due to damage to the roots that occurs during transportation. Yellowing of the foliage is usually caused by adaptation. To strengthen the seedlings, growth stimulants such as Immunocytophyte, EPIN, and Heteroauxin are used.

Fungal diseases of cabbage and their control

Fungi often cause entire crop losses. Cruciferous plants and their varieties are often affected. Control measures are selected after the pathogen is identified. To achieve a powerful therapeutic or preventative effect, experts recommend a combination of traditional, agricultural, and chemical methods.

Fungal diseases

The list of diseases is quite extensive and includes:

  • Clubroot. Young plants are at risk. The Plasmodiophora fungus can be transmitted to seedlings during ventilation and watering. Insects are the vectors of the infection. Characteristic symptoms include growths on various parts of the root system, wilting, and slow growth. Infected seedlings cannot be cured, so they are destroyed. Empty planting holes are sprinkled with lime for disinfection. It is important to note that the disease only affects plants from the Cruciferae family. Therefore, the soil can be used for planting other crops.
  • Fusarium wilt. In this case, the imperfect fungus Fusarium oxysporum f. sp. conglutinans causes wilting. After it penetrates the vascular system, the leaves begin to turn yellow. The veins, however, remain the same rich color as before. The resulting heads are not large or regularly shaped. Affected plants are sprayed with fungicides (Topsin-M, Benomyl, Tecto).
  • Downy mildew. This disease is often called false powdery mildew. The fungus Peronospora brassicae Guum affects all varieties of cruciferous plants. Infection of cabbage is indicated by poor seedling development, the appearance of a whitish coating and yellow spots on the leaves, and the drying out of affected plant parts. Downy mildew progresses with high humidity. Cabbage diseases are treated with products such as Ridomil Gold, Bordeaux mixture solution, and Phytophthora. Each product comes with instructions for use.

To prevent fungal diseases, it's important to practice crop rotation, disinfect the soil, and remove weeds promptly. Particular attention should be paid to the quality of the seed and soil moisture.

Viral diseases of cabbage: description and treatment

They are much less common than fungal diseases. Viruses are characterized by rapid pathogenicity. Once introduced into a garden plot via soil, seeds, water, insects, and dirty tools, they quickly attack crops. Failure to take preventative measures can result in the loss of an entire cabbage harvest. Cauliflower diseases are virtually impossible to cure. Insecticides are useless in this case.

The mosaic virus is the most common. This "family" includes numerous species. The disease can harm many ornamental and edible crops. For example, Mosaic caulivirus infects cauliflower. The virus only manifests itself 3-4 weeks after planting the seedlings in the ground. Characteristic signs include leaf necrosis and a dark green border along the veins.

Cabbage mosaic

Turnip mosaic virus is the pathogen that causes ringspot. Light green spots form on the underside of cabbage leaves, which later merge and darken. The cabbage head does not have time to form, as the affected leaves simply fall off.

The risk of infection increases due to the following factors:

  • negative impact of parasites;
  • sowing infected seeds;
  • Direct contact of cabbage seedlings with virus carriers, which can be either insects or weeds;
  • mechanical damage.

Plants infected with viral and fungal infections will have to be destroyed.

This is the only way to stop the spread of the disease.

Treatment of the remaining ones should begin immediately after identifying the disease that has affected the cabbage.

Cabbage pests

They are especially dangerous for young plants. The parasites damage tissue integrity and infect seedlings with fungal and viral diseases. To ensure a healthy harvest, regular preventative treatments are necessary, and if any alarming symptoms appear, prompt treatment is required.

Cabbage aphids are small insects with a silvery-white hue. These pests feed on sap and prefer to inhabit young plants. Their colonies can be found on the underside of leaves. Their activity results in:

  • depletion and slowing of growth of seedlings;
  • discoloration and curling of leaf blades.

Without timely treatment, the seedlings will die. Cabbage foliage can be removed with insecticides, such as Karate, Karbofos, and Iskra. Experienced gardeners repel the pests with infusions made from onion peels and garlic, as well as strong odors. Another effective measure is good neighborhoods. To prevent aphids, plant tomatoes and carrots near cabbage.

Cabbage pests

Both cauliflower and cabbage can be affected by cabbage flies. These pests resemble insects that often fly into homes during the warmer months. The parasite becomes active in late May. Young larvae, hatched from eggs laid in the soil, eagerly feed on the roots of cruciferous plants. This causes the plant to wilt, and the lower leaves lose their natural color and turn gray. For medicinal purposes, plants can be sprayed with a solution of Thiophos and Chlorophos. A mixture of tobacco and lime, sand, and naphthalene can be used to repel pests.

Cabbage seedlings (kohlrabi, Brussels sprouts, broccoli, and white cabbage) are also a target for cruciferous flea beetles. These elongated black beetles live in the soil and feed on young cruciferous seedlings. These pests can be controlled with a soap solution and wood ash. Insecticides such as Aktara and Karbofos are recommended.

Thrips are indicated by slower plant growth and yellowing foliage. In this case, the plantings and soil are treated with biological pesticides such as Antonem-F and Nemabakt. The most effective folk remedy is dusting the seedlings with a mixture of tobacco dust and wood ash.

The list of mandatory preventive measures includes:

  • timely removal of weeds;
  • loosening the soil;
  • Planting suitable neighbors. It's best to plant Apanteles, Trichogramma, and marigolds near cabbage;
  • Using natural enemies. In this case, these are Anthocorys and Orius.

Gardeners who plant cabbage annually should be wary of cabbage bugs. They are distinguished by their bright coloring and small size. To get rid of these pests, plants are treated with Actellic, celandine (in powder form), and dust.

Resistant varieties of white cabbage

Resistance to pests, fungal, and viral diseases is a factor to consider when purchasing seed. Climate, soil composition, and seed characteristics are also important factors to consider. Among the early-ripening varieties are the following:

  • Tobia;
  • Cossack;
  • June;
  • Rinda.

The list of the most stable late varieties includes Mara, Agressor, Kolobok, Amager and Valentina.

Seedlings require attention and constant care. Disease-resistant cabbage is the key to a bountiful autumn harvest. Knowing how to treat cabbage for the diseases listed above can save damaged plants and prevent infection in healthy ones.
